Business Summary
Newmont Corporation operates as a gold producer. It also explores for copper, silver, lead, zinc, and other metals. It has operations and/or assets in the United States, Papua New Guinea, Australia, Ghana, Suriname, Argentina, Dominican Republic, Chile, Peru, Ecuador, Mexico, and Canada. The company was founded in 1916 and is headquartered in Denver, Colorado.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are healthcare stocks and why are they important to investors?
Healthcare stocks include pharmaceutical companies, biotech firms, hospitals, and medical device manufacturers.
Are healthcare stocks less volatile?
Generally yes. Because healthcare is a necessity, demand remains relatively steady, making the sector less sensitive to economic cycles.
What drives growth in healthcare investments?
Aging populations, technological advancements, and increased healthcare spending contribute to long-term growth in the sector.
What are the risks of investing in healthcare?
Regulatory changes, drug approval delays, and legal challenges can affect the profitability and stock prices of healthcare companies.
